Alpine st gives an amazing texture – just the name of it makes me drift back to happy days exploring the Lake District (hence the name Buttermere Beanie).
It’s worked from the bottom up, and can be made in 3 styles: fitted, slouchy and messy bun. The hat and brim are worked in one piece for added durability – plus, you’ll have fewer ends to weave in!
The hat is made-to-measure, but I’ve included a size / measurements chart below for those who don’t have the ability to actually take measurements. You’ll need to meet gauge to get the height right since it’s worked in sections.
It’s worked in closed rnds without turning so you shouldn’t need to use st markers. The starting ch does not count as a st so the 1st st is made in the same st as the ch, and rnds are closed with a slst to the top of the 1st st is made in the same st as the ch, and rnds are closed with a slst to the top of the 1st st in the rnd.
You'll find a photo tutorial & st guide to help with unfamiliar sts / techniques.
